Our philosophy at THF:

Most initiatives - change, innovation, responding to crisis or changing circumstances - exist in interconnected systems of stakeholders with complex relationships, conflicting goals, and complicated internal & external forces. Often, these 'human factors' block change and hinder innovation - to the point that the majority of efforts fail. The Human Factor was created to be a different kind of consultancy. We’re a strategy firm focused on the power of stakeholder engagement: We find, understand, and convene the key players affected by a problem space or opportunity area to negotiate between conflicting goals & devise stakeholder-vetted strategies that challenge the status quo. 

In some cases, bringing external expert perspectives to the stakeholder panels we assemble for our clients can help spark the best ideas and uncover potential downsides—for example, if we are looking to break through a stalemate or looking for how loopholes might be exploited. As a Subject Matter Expert, your role is to draw on your expertise or unconventional experiences to generate creative solutions and test potential directions alongside our clients. This means that we look for people-smart and shrewd candidates with deep knowledge in their domain of expertise. We place high value on self-awareness, collaboration, communication prowess, and willingness to challenge ‘how it’s always been done’ in a realistic, human-centered way

What we will pull you into:

  • Partake in qualitative interviews to bring data and nuance to a client challenge or opportunity.

  • Participate in workshops to prioritize findings and distill key insights to produce client-facing deliverables that make tangible recommendations. 

  • Contribute to stakeholder panels to debunk assumptions, generate solutions, uncover vulnerabilities, and proactively mitigate risk.

  • Optional: Support publication efforts to share academic findings with thought leaders in our space.

Examples of past expert stakeholders: 

Our network of contributors includes thought leaders and experts— such as transplant surgeons, top drone manufacturers, and researchers from leading universities. And, we engage unconventional thinkers that help spot loopholes, such as law enforcement, private security, and—when appropriate—the occasional rule breaker. In the past, we have engaged experts from sectors spanning entertainment to national defense and security for a fresh and comprehensive perspective of our clients’ unique needs. 

What we are looking for:

Experience: 10+ years of experience in your domain of expertise; familiarity with consulting, design strategy, negotiation, conflict management, and/or behavioral sciences (qualitative research, frameworks, analysis of diverse evidence) is a plus.

Human-First Posture: You are able to move your ego aside and understand that the most successful solutions are not based on ideology but on a combination of empathy, pragmatism, and evidence-based iteration. You are not satisfied with obvious answers that compromise either our clients’ objectives or salient human needs. 

Analytical Rigor: You are committed to holding data accountable and using rigorous testing to decide the right course of action rather than relying on assumptions; a strong grasp of qualitative and quantitative methods, experimental design, and stakeholder or system analysis is a plus.

Business Sense: You are a holistic, strategic thinker who constantly connects the dots between ideas, problems, organizations, and how ethical & sustained impact can be achieved; strong verbal & written skills are a must.

Strong Opinions, Loosely Held: You approach new topics, develop your perspective, articulate nuance, and productively challenge the status quo. Equally, you must approach productive disagreement with curiosity and adjust your stance when new evidence is introduced.

Integrity within Conflict: You are willing to start the conversation on tough challenges in a global world without assumed vilification of any stakeholder. Approaching real-world problems is core to our work; open discussion of our values and biases is a must. 

Culture: You are an independent thinker comfortable working in an often ambiguous and dynamic environment; proactivity is a must.
